Every teen deserves care that feels safe, affirming, and rooted in who they truly are. 💛

For LGBTQIA+ teens, mental health support isn’t just about learning coping skills — it’s about being seen, respected, and supported without having to explain or defend their identity. Affirming care creates space for teens to show up authentically, build trust, and focus on healing rather than survival.

At Bright Path, we intentionally provide LGBTQIA+ affirming care that honors each teen’s identity, pronouns, and lived experience. Our programs offer structure, connection, and evidence-based skills in an environment where teens know they belong.

Because when teens feel affirmed, they’re more likely to engage, build resilience, and experience meaningful growth.

Every teen deserves care that meets them where they are — and celebrates who they are becoming. 🌈✨

On this Juneteenth we want to take a moment to recognize history, freedom, and progress by sharing staff perspectives on what today means to them.

DeMetrice Via, Education Liasion Bright Path Hillsborough, on why Juneteenth matters: “The legacy of systemic racism continues to affect many aspects of life for Black communities, including access to quality healthcare and mental health services. For generations, Black Americans have faced barriers to care, cultural stigma surrounding mental health, underdiagnosis, misdiagnosis, and a lack of providers who reflect and understand their lived experiences. These inequities, coupled with the effects of historical and generational trauma, have contributed to significant disparities in mental health outcomes and access to treatment.

Recognizing Juneteenth at Bright Path is important because the work of behavioral health cannot be separated from the social and historical realities that shape people's lives. Understanding how systemic inequities have influenced mental health allows us to provide more compassionate, culturally responsive, and equitable care. It challenges us to see the whole person, not just their symptoms, and to recognize the broader experiences, barriers, and histories that impact well-being. By acknowledging this history, we honor the resilience of those who came before us while reaffirming our commitment to creating spaces where every individual feels seen, valued, understood, and supported.”
